NERVA Globe is a signal intelligence surface built on quantum-inspired decision mathematics. Every bar rising from the globe is a NERVA node — a geopolitical actor, climate system, insurance market, financial hub, or local risk zone. The bar's height tells you how readable the signal is. The color tells you what decision the math recommends.
The key insight: You are not looking down at a map. You are standing outside the globe and every node is broadcasting a signal at you. Some signals are clean and actionable. Some are pure noise. NERVA tells you which is which.

Reading the Bars
Bar height is the inverse of entropy — the lower the entropy (more decision coherence), the taller the bar. A tall green bar means "clean signal, act here." A short red bar means "noise, stand aside." A short red bar with a purple ring means the node is chaotic now but trending toward commitment — that's the opportunity signal.
Hover any bar for an instant tooltip that explains its height in plain English before you click into the full analysis.

The Math (Plain English)
NERVA uses von Neumann entropy from quantum mechanics — a measurement of how mixed or uncertain a quantum state is. Applied to decision-making: high entropy = many equally plausible outcomes = noise. Low entropy = state has collapsed to a clear trajectory = signal.
Each node lives on a Bloch sphere — a sphere where the north pole is COMMIT (pure eigenstate, clean signal) and the equator is maximum uncertainty. The small Bloch diagram in each node's detail panel shows exactly where on that sphere the decision state sits.
The time horizon slider at the bottom shifts the entropy calculation across six time windows from 24 hours to 10 years. Watch what happens when you slide from flash crisis to civilizational scale — some nodes that are TOXIC now become COMMIT at 10 years. That transition is the opportunity surface.

The inversion principle: A node that reads TOXIC at 24h but COMMIT at 10yr is not contradictory — it means the system is in a painful transition toward a locked state. Iran at 24h is maximum entropy war. At 10yr, some form of resolution (regime change, exhaustion, normalization) has collapsed the superposition. The gap between these states is where NERVA finds asymmetric value.
What Changes vs What Stays Fixed
Changes with horizon: Event-driven entropy, political volatility, financial noise, tactical military situations. These are high-frequency oscillations that decay out over time.
Stays fixed regardless of horizon: Geography (chokepoints, arable land), demographics (India's dividend is locked regardless of government), physics (Arctic ice melt trajectory, Cascadia subduction return period). These nodes read the same at 24h and 10yr because the underlying attractor is the same — what changes is only the entropy wrapping around them.
The most important 10-year signal: Find nodes that are ESCALATE or TOXIC at 24h but COMMIT at 10yr, AND where the gap is driven by physics/demographics rather than politics. These are the ones where the 10yr trajectory is nearly certain even though the path is volatile. That's where NERVA's opportunity layer pays off most — you can see the destination clearly even when the road is chaotic.

The Opportunity Layer
The ◈ Opportunity Surface inverts NERVA's normal logic. Instead of flagging clean signals, it identifies nodes that are TOXIC or ESCALATE at the current horizon but trend toward COMMIT or HOLD at the 2-year horizon. This is the asymmetric entry calculation — maximum fear priced in now, trajectory improving later.
Opportunity Score (0–100) is computed from the entropy gap between current and 2-year states, amplified if the node has explicit contrarian logic attached. Each opportunity node in the detail panel shows the specific investment or decision thesis.
